Strachan hails Scotland's mental strength

Scotland was "too strung out" in the first half of its 5-1 win over Malta, according to Gordon Strachan.

Gordon Strachan praised the mental strength of his Scotland players after they survived a scare to run out 5-1 winners in a World Cup qualifying game against Malta.

A hat trick from Robert Snodgrass, along with goals from Chris Martin and Steven Fletcher, made the final result an emphatic one for Scotland, but Strachan admitted he feared the worst after Alfred Effiong equalized for Malta early in the game.

Exactly one year ago, Scotland's hopes of qualifying for Euro 2016 suffered a blow with a defeat in Georgia, but there was to be no repeat of that disappointment – particularly when Malta had two players sent off in the second half.
